Ornamental Frosting Ii Recipe
From LoveToKnow Recipes
Ingredients for Ornamental Frosting Ii
- Whites 3 eggs
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- Confectioners' sugar, sifted
Instructions
- Put eggs in a large bowl, add two tablespoons sugar, and beat three minutes, using a perforated wooden spoon.
- Repeat until one and one-half cups sugar are used.
- Add lemon juice gradually, as mixture thickens.
- Continue adding sugar by spoonfuls, and beating until frosting is stiff enough to spread.
- This may be determined by taking up some of mixture on back of spoon, and with a case knife making a cut through mixture; if knife makes a clean cut and frosting remains parted, it is of right consistency.
- Spread cake thinly with frosting; when this has hardened, put on a thicker layer, having mixture somewhat stiffer than first coating, and then crease for cutting.
- To remaining frosting add enough more sugar, that frosting may keep in shape after being forced through a pastry bag and tube.
- With a pastry bag and variety of tubes, cake may be ornamented as desired.
